There's a 0.3 second delay from when you stop Rapid Fire to when you can start it up again. So yes... in a way he's right.
With Demolition, you're still vulnerable during the time you have to stand still, though. And then you get KBed and have to reposition yourself.

After you stop Rapid Fire, you can't use it again until 0.3 seconds later. You can walk or do whatever else in that time frame, though.
On second thought it's that minus one bullet, so 0.18 seconds.

Yeah. A delay that's always there is included in casting time. If it only blocks repeated use of the skill, but not other actions i.e. movement or other skills, then it's not part of the actual casting time, and therefore spamming it is slower than the casting time (which is the important thing).
And - if you tank hits (which seems to be not advisable, but still), Cannon has no interruption when being hit. Neither does Triple Fire, if you're still stuck with that.
